<<I was wondering, how do you know (after the rubber seals are in place)
how far to screw in the upper and lower links into the spindle before
you reattach them to the shock (upper) and the wishbone arm (lower). It
seems to me that this is a very important reassembly item.>>

Make sure the distance pieces are in place and yoyu'll find that at a certain
point screwing the trunion on farther will bind on the distance piece - back
off about a turn so that you have full steering range without interference.
Of course if the distance piece isn't in place, you will eventually bottom on
the king pin as well, but you will be even farther in than you want to be.
When you have them at the right point, assemble them to the a-arms and then
see what sort of play you have - if the trunion rocks on the king pin much at
all, it is replacement time.
